Join the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) on Thursday, October 2nd at 1:00 PM ET for a 1-hour Internet Networking Web Meeting to learn how school districts across the country are increasing energy efficiency through ENERGY STAR®.
Who should attend: Facilities, EHS, IT, and Finance managers interested in reducing schools’ energy costs and establishing or enhancing a sustainability program for new schools and buildings.
Participants will learn about:
- The newly updated ENERGY STAR Building Upgrade Manual, a strategic guide designed to help building owners and managers plan and implement energy saving upgrades. By using the Building Upgrade Manual, organizations can maximize energy savings through five upgrade stages based on the success of ENERGY STAR partners.
- How Council Rock School District in Pennsylvania won the 2008 ENERGY STAR Partner of the Year Award for Energy Management. Director of Business Administration Robert Schoch, and Energy Manager Mike McGarvey will discuss how their district used ENERGY STAR tools and resources to improve energy performance by 30 percent and earn the ENERGY STAR for 17 schools. Mr. Schoch will also discuss how the district used a strategic approach and educated students about the importance of energy efficiency.
